A national Pro-Life Organization is pushing legislation in states aimed at making sure pregnant women and girls view sonograms before having abortions, hoping that what they see will persuade them against having the procedure.

KUMED leaders are launching an $800 million initiative aimed at plugging a gap in the region’s bioscience economy. It also calls for growing or establishing new research and care centers that would depend heavily on other area organizations such as Saint Luke’s Hospital, Children’s Mercy Hospitals and Clinics and the Stowers Institute for Medical Research.
